Introduction of Alumina Ceramic Materials

Alumina, a precision ceramic material, offers high hardness, chemical stability, temperature resistance, and electrical insulation. It’s vital for wear-resistant components, chemical vessels, high-temperature elements, electronic insulators, and precision parts.

1. Broad Applications and Balanced Mechanical Performance

Alumina is widely appreciated for its balanced mechanical properties, including high strength, hardness, and excellent wear resistance. These characteristics allow alumina to play a crucial role in various fields.

  • High-Temperature Industrial Applications: Alumina is highly prevalent in the manufacturing of refractory materials for high-temperature industrial furnaces. Its high melting point and stability enable it to operate in extreme high-temperature environments without deformation or damage.
  • Electronic Components: Alumina is also extensively used in the electronics industry, particularly in manufacturing substrates, insulators, and packaging materials. Its outstanding electrical insulation and thermal conductivity make it an ideal material for electronic components.

2. Stability in Chemical and Physical Properties

Alumina’s stability in chemical and physical properties makes it indispensable in precision industries.

  • Thermal Properties: Alumina’s heat resistance and good thermal conductivity make it very useful in applications requiring rapid heat dissipation, such as in LED lighting and power electronics.
  • Mechanical Properties: High strength and hardness ensure alumina’s durability under physical stress, which is particularly crucial in aerospace and automotive manufacturing.
  • Other Properties: Alumina’s high electrical insulation and strong corrosion resistance make it suitable for chemical processing environments and electrical applications. Additionally, its high biocompatibility also makes it highly favored in medical devices and bio-implant materials.
